REPORT | Dulwich Hamlet vs Carshalton Athletic

The Hamlet kicked off the festive season with a huge victory over Carshalton Athletic in front of 2883 supporters at Champion Hill. 

On an overcast afternoon the Hamlet took on a Carshalton side unbeaten in 11 matches. The Hamlet on the other hand hadn't won since they defeated Potters Bar Town on November 9th. 

It took just five minutes for this game to be fired into life. The visitors unleashed a strike from range but Dillon Barnes got down to deny them with relative ease. 

Five minutes later and it was the Hamlet who would be celebrating. Kreshnic Krasniqi who met a corner and fired his header home to put the Hamlet ahead. 

Seven minutes later and Dillon Barnes would be called into action again this time to deny the visitors from a freekick. The strike took a deflection off of the wall and left Barnes scrambling to acrobatically tip the shot over the bar. 

The next 20 minutes or so were relatively quiet with neither side creating any major chances. Hassan Ibrahiym almost had the Hamlet 2 ahead but his curling effort went wide of the post. 

The Hamlet would almost be 2 ahead after 3 minutes of the 2nd half Carshalton tried to play out from the back but played a pass straight into the path of Anthony Jeffrey who squared it to Luke Wanadio but he couldn't get the shot away. 

Carshalton went close after 55 minutes with a quick counter attack but they fired a shot at the back post over. 

A change in Hamlet formation for this one meant that the Hamlet thwarted most of their attacks resulting in the Robins taking shots from range. 

Despite late pressure from the Robins which included an offside strike against the woodwork the Hamlet would secure a relatively comfortable victory to kick-off a busy run of fixtures before heading to take on Whitehawk on Saturday.
